I am assembling my small block stroker and measured the connecting Rod side clearance.
The spec seems to be .009 to .017. Two are .014 the other two are .024, is this OK.
Not sure what to do, should I try mixing up the rods? The crank is a MP stroker and the rods are Eagle H beams. All bought in 2001 so its too late to return anything. If swapping the rods around does not work im not sure what can be done to correct it.

I've put stuff together with .024 or more and it will be fine.

Thanks, after getting my head out of the book, i read the sheet that came with the rods and that said up to .025 so i am good.
